Pursuant to due call and notice thereof, the City Council for the City of SI. Joseph met in regular session
on Thursday, Juiy 31,2003 at 7:00 PM in the SI. Joseph City Hall.
Members Present: Mayor Larry Hosch. Councilors Gary Utsch, AI Rassier, Ross Rieke, Dale Wick.
Administrator Judy Weyrens.

Eastyold stated that the proposed bond issue will be insured by underwriter at their cost. The City
received low rates due to the insurance of the bond issue. By adding insurance the bond issue was ra ed
AAA, the highest rate possibie.
The following is a summary of the bid results: (Net effective interest rate)
Wells Fargo 2.3729%
RBC Dain Rausher 2.4690%
United Bankers' 2.5048%
Cronin & Co. 2.5351%
US Bancorp Piper Jaffray 2.5496%
Wachovia Bank 2.6740%
Hosch made a motion to approve CC Resolution 2003-_ Providing for the Issuance and Sale of $
2,135,000 General Obligation Bonds of 2003, accepting the low bid of Wells Fargo. The motion'
was seconded by Utsch and passed unanimously. I
Maintenance Worker Hire: Weyrens reported the Hiring Committee met and interviewed 14 candidates
for the position of Maintenance Worker. Weyrens stated that all applicants submitting an application were
offered the opportunity to test for the position. The test was a combination of traffic, common sense and
mechanicai (practical) aptitude which has been used by the State of Minnesota in the past to test pUblic
works employees. The test comprised of 100 questions and all candidates scoring 80 or above were I
interviewed. I
,
Rassier stated it is his opinion the process for reducing the candidates was fair and equitable and the I
hiring committee interviewed14 qualified candidates. The Hiring Committee recommended the Council
offer the position of Maintenance Worker to Randy Torborg. '
I
Rassier made a motion to hire Randy Torborg to fill the vacant Maintenance Worker position. The
motion was seconded by Rieke and passed unanimously.
,
Finance Officer Position: Weyrens reported that Tracy Snyder has submitted her resignation of
employment effective August 14, 2003. The Council requested Weyrens research alternative methods to
filling the vacant position of Finance Officer and report back to the Council. !
